The CL11 benchtop display unit is the latest development of an inexpensive multiple parameter meter that
simultaneously measures and records CO2, humidity and temperature. Equipped with the field-tested
ROTRONIC HYGROMER® IN-1 humidity sensor, this instrument offers unbeatable value for money. Using the
ROTRONIC software package SW21, it can be easily set to record as required and data can then be downloaded,
saved and analyzed.

PRINCIPLES
The CL11 data logger evaluates air quality with the combined measurements of CO2, humidity, and temperature. These
measurements are important to understand Indoor Air Quality (IAQ) in classrooms, conference and waiting rooms, as well as any
indoor areas where people gather. A high concentration of carbon dioxide can develop quickly when closed rooms with insuffi cient
ventilation are fi lled with people.

CO2 measurement
Measurement principle Non dispersive infrared (NDIR)
Measurement range 0…5,000 ppm
Accuracy at 23 °C ±5 K ±30 ppm ±5 % of the measured value
Response time <10 sec @ 30 cc/min. fl ow, <3 min diffusion time
Adjustment point Automatic calibration, manual calibration at 400 ppm
Pressure dependence +1.6 % reading per kPa
Null drift <10 ppm/year
Maintenance No maintenance (standard indoor application)
with automatic baseline correction (ABC)
Humidity measurement
Humidity sensor ROTRONIC HYGROMER® IN-1
Measurement range 0...100 %RH
Accuracy at 23 °C ±5 K <2.5 %RH (10...90 %RH)
Adjustment points 35, 80 %RH
Response time τ63 <30 s, without fi lter
Long-term stability <1.5 %RH / year
Temperature measurement
Sensor Thermistor
Measurement range -20...60 °C
Accuracy at 23 °C ±5 K ±0.3 °K
Response time 4 s
